| <?xml version="1.0" encoding="UTF-8"?>
|
| <!--
|
| Copyright (c) 2022 Willink Transformations and others.
|
| All rights reserved. This program and the accompanying materials
|
| are made available under the terms of the Eclipse Public License v2.0
|
| which accompanies this distribution, and is available at
|
| http://www.eclipse.org/legal/epl-v20.html
|
|
|
| Contributors:
|
| E.D.Willink - initial API and implementation
|
| --> |
| |
| <javammsi:Package xmi:version="2.0" xmlns:xmi="http://www.omg.org/XMI"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:javammsi="http://www.eclipse.org/qvtd/xtext/qvtrelation/tests/mitosi/java"
|
| xsi:schemaLocation="http://www.eclipse.org/qvtd/xtext/qvtrelation/tests/mitosi/java ../javaMM.emof#javammsi"
|
| name="transport">
|
| <containsClass extendedBy="#TwoWheeler #ThreeWheeler #FourWheeler" name="Vehicle"/>
|
| <containsClass extends="#Vehicle" implements="#TwoStrokeEngine" name="TwoWheeler"/>
|
| <containsClass extends="#Vehicle" implements="#TwoStrokeEngine" name="ThreeWheeler"/>
|
| <containsClass extends="#Vehicle" implements="#FourStrokeEngine" name="FourWheeler"/>
|
| <containsInterface extendedBy="#SteamEngine #ICEngine" name="Engine"/>
|
| <containsInterface extends="#Engine" name="SteamEngine"/>
|
| <containsInterface extends="#Engine" extendedBy="#TwoStrokeEngine #FourStrokeEngine" name="ICEngine"/>
|
| <containsInterface implementedBy="#TwoWheeler #ThreeWheeler" extends="#ICEngine" name="TwoStrokeEngine"/>
|
| <containsInterface implementedBy="#FourWheeler" extends="#ICEngine" name="FourStrokeEngine"/>
|
| </javammsi:Package>
|